Output 78e5b662ae529d71a26650ef42473e160722e56b285f46acec2834f2ebb13a02:1

value
1000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 52f97494cd0db2dd4607a9076163146afafdfe7b OP_EQUALVERIFY OP_CHECKSIG
address
18ZjFCJRRcL6hftUJdaoj61dHEgFNPG7VP
transaction
78e5b662ae529d71a26650ef42473e160722e56b285f46acec2834f2ebb13a02
confirmations
636623
spent
true